首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用python Beautifulsoup抓取具有相同类的多个值的数据

使用Python的BeautifulSoup库可以方便地抓取具有相同类的多个值的数据。BeautifulSoup是一个用于解析HTML和XML文档的库,它提供了一种简单而灵活的方式来遍历、搜索和修改文档树。

在使用BeautifulSoup抓取具有相同类的多个值的数据时,可以按照以下步骤进行操作:

  1. 导入必要的库:
代码语言:txt
复制
from bs4 import BeautifulSoup
import requests
  1. 发送HTTP请求并获取页面内容:
代码语言:txt
复制
url = "待抓取的网页URL"
response = requests.get(url)
content = response.content
  1. 创建BeautifulSoup对象并解析页面内容:
代码语言:txt
复制
soup = BeautifulSoup(content, 'html.parser')
  1. 使用find_all方法查找具有相同类的多个值的元素:
代码语言:txt
复制
elements = soup.find_all('tag', class_='class_name')

其中,tag是要查找的HTML标签,class_是要查找的类名。

  1. 遍历并处理找到的元素:
代码语言:txt
复制
for element in elements:
    # 处理每个元素的数据
    data = element.text
    # 其他操作...

在处理每个元素的数据时,可以根据具体需求进行提取、清洗、存储等操作。

对于BeautifulSoup的更多用法和详细说明,可以参考腾讯云开发者文档中的相关介绍:BeautifulSoup使用指南

需要注意的是,以上答案中没有提及具体的腾讯云产品,因为题目要求不涉及云计算品牌商。但是,腾讯云提供了丰富的云计算产品和服务,可以根据具体需求选择适合的产品进行开发和部署。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券